How Our Carpet Pad Water Extraction Service Works
Our Carpet Pad Water Extraction process is designed to restore your home to its pre-loss condition. We follow a meticulous approach to ensure every step is taken to prevent further damage and restore your carpet pad. Our team’s experience and IICRC certification guarantee a successful outcome.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ection to identify the extent of the water damage, pinpointing the source and affected areas. This initial assessment helps us develop an effective extraction plan.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using state-of-the-art equipment, our team will extract the water from the carpet pad, ensuring a thorough removal to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ll employ industrial-strength drying equipment and dehumidifiers to remove any remaining moisture from the carpet pad, carpets, and underlying surfaces.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Our team will sanitize and disinfect the affected area to remove any bacteria, viruses, or other microorganisms that may have been present due to the water dam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ration
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ure the carpet pad, carpets, and underlying surfaces are completely dry and free from any signs of water damage. We’ll make any necessary repairs to restore your home to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Carpet Pad Water Extraction
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Catching these signs early is crucial in preventing further damage. Our team will help you identify and address the following war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ors from your carpet pad can show a more significant issue. These odors can be a sign of mildew, mold, or bacterial growth. Our team will assess the situation and provide the necessary treatment to remove the odor and prevent further damage.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can signal a leak in your roof or pipes. It’s essential to address this iss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s. Our team will help you identify and fix the source of the leak, ensuring your home remains safe and secure.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show that the underlying carpet pad has been damaged. This can lead to costly repairs and even compromise the structural integrity of your home. Our team will assess the situation and provide the necessary repairs to restore your flooring to its original condition.
Unpleasant Slime or Grime on Your Carpet
Visible slime or grime on your carpet can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a clogged drain or a leak in your pipes. Our team will help you identify the source of the problem and provide the necessary treatment to remove the slime and prevent further damage.

Carpet Pad Water Extraction Cost in Hackettstown, NJ
The cost of Carpet Pad Water Extraction in Hackettstown, NJ can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, but the actual cost will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and can provide you with a detailed breakdown of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$300 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$200 – $1,000 | Amount of water, complexity of the job |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of the affected area, duration of the drying process |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$150 – $500 | Extent of contamination, type of disinfectant used |
| Final Inspection and Restoration | $200 – $1,000 | Complexity of the job, number of repairs needed |
